Chlorination of Lower Hutt's drinking water will continue permanently

Hutt City Council

This follows a decision made by Greater Wellington Regional Council (GWRC) this morning. The decision was based on an investigation by Wellington Water which you can read on our website where there's also links to more information about the decision: www.huttcity.govt.nz...

Our Mayor Ray Wallace says about the decision by GWRC: "no chances should ever be taken when it comes to drinking water quality.
“No one wants a repeat of the Havelock North experience. Public safety has always been our number one priority, and we must continue to listen to the experts who tell us that a combination of chlorination and UV treatment for our network is the best long-term approach.

“It’s fantastic that we’re also able to offer an un-chlorinated solution in Lower Hutt for those that prefer it at the Buick Street and Dowse Square fountains. These fountains are now both open and treated with a UV filter and filtration. At the flow-rate of water from the fountains, the UV and filtration provides effective barriers against possible contaminants and means the water complies with the Drinking Water Standards of New Zealand.While it is sad that this has happened and investigations have not found a single root cause, it is something we must accept and I am confident that the best possible solution has been found for our city.”
